Swapping her lab coat for lesson plans, Laura found an exciting new direction in vocational education. After a 15-year career with ACT Pathology, Laura is now a passionate laboratory studies teacher at the Canberra Institute of Technology (CIT).
With a strong foundation in science, a passion for teaching, and a commitment to student success, Laura manages the laboratory studies programs at CIT. She has introduced innovative learning strategies, such as escape room challenges and structured work placements that have engaged students and led to meaningful employment outcomes. As a dedicated advocate for vocational learning, Laura actively collaborates with industry partners and mentors her peers to ensure the Institute’s laboratory programs remain current and job-focused.
To ensure students are well-prepared for meaningful careers in science, Laura is expanding access to STEM and refining training packages to meet the evolving needs of industry. There’s no doubt about it. She’s a STEM-sational educator.
